Abercynon Station may not boast a bustling ticket office, but it simplifies the process with modern ticket machines that support quick and easy ticket collections. These machines have been cleverly designed to accommodate all travelers, offering accessible ticketing with support for major debit and credit cards, although they don't accept cash. For tech-savvy travelers, the presence of smartcard validators ensures a seamless transition between different parts of the journey.
The station’s facilities cater to everyday commuter needs. While there are no dedicated waiting rooms, there is ample seating available. Travelers can rest assured with the availability of CCTV and help points, providing a safe and informed environment. Unfortunately, the station lacks luggage storage, refreshment facilities, and luxury lounges, but travelers can rely on the extensive transport links for their onward journeys or plan stops at nearby amenities.
Abercynon aims to provide accessible travel to as many passengers as possible. It offers step-free access and ramps with handrails are available for both platforms, classifying it as Category B2 on the accessibility scale. Although wheelchair availability and waiting rooms are absent, the station compensates with accessible parking options. The staff helpdesk and comprehensive customer information through screens and announcements ensure that travelers with different needs are catered to.

Smithy Bridge Train Station may be small, but it is equipped to handle the basic needs of its passengers. While there isn’t a ticket office available, the station offers ticket machines, which are accessible and strategically placed near the pathway to the Manchester-bound platform. For those with hearing disabilities, an induction loop is available on-site. Although seating areas and waiting rooms are unavailable, the station ensures full security with CCTV coverage.
Accessibility is partially provided with step-free access to the platforms via road and level crossings, although potential travelers should note the absence of tactile paving. Furthermore, there are no restroom facilities or refreshment outlets, so do plan ahead if your journey involves a wait.
The station’s connection with local transport networks doesn’t stop at the train lines. For those continuing their journey beyond the tracks, there are rail replacement services that pick up and drop off at the bus stops by the level crossing. While there aren't any close bus stops or bicycle hires nearby, taxis can be conveniently booked via this link. For those with a penchant for cycling, note that no bicycle storage facilities are offered at the station.
